
FABRIQUE DES MOBILITÉS QUÉBEC
Center of Excellence in Open Innovation to engage Quebec communities around sustainable mobility technology commons
The Quebec Mobility Factory is a center of excellence in open innovation on mobility issues. By bringing together entrepreneurs, startups, public actors and citizens, we support the deployment of sustainable mobility solutions providing methodological resources and commonalities to facilitate the identification by communities of added value for their citizens. Beyond that, we coach innovative teams to strengthen their culture of experimentation and product development in agility so that the growth of their business value is as sustainable as possible.
